About Léo Paly

Léo Paly is a scholar working on Clinical Psychology, Cognitive Neuroscience, Experimental and Cognitive Psychology, Social Psychology and Neurology, having authored 5 papers that have together received 17 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Sleep and related disorders (2 papers), COVID-19 and Mental Health (2 papers), Sleep and Wakefulness Research (2 papers), Mindfulness and Compassion Interventions (2 papers), Psychological Well-being and Life Satisfaction (1 paper), Long-Term Effects of COVID-19 (1 paper), Resilience and Mental Health (1 paper) and Stroke Rehabilitation and Recovery (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Experimental and Cognitive Psychology (7 citations), Cognitive Neuroscience (7 citations), Developmental Neuroscience (1 citation), Clinical Psychology (4 citations) and Endocrine and Autonomic Systems (1 citation). Léo Paly has collaborated with scholars based in France, United Kingdom and Belgium. Frequent co-authors include Gaël Chételat, Marion Delarue, Vincent de La Sayette, Stéphane Rehel, Valentin Ourry, Géraldine Rauchs, Natalie L. Marchant, Fabienne Collette, Julie Gonneaud and Olga Klimecki. Their work appears in journals such as Alzheimer s & Dementia, Aging and Scientific Reports.
